LongDescription#@#NA#@@#Cleaning Instructions#@#Unplug unit and remove ice pans. Scrape loose debris from stainless steel interior and top. Wash surfaces with mild soap and warm water; rinse and dry. Flush pan drains and clear gravity coil area. Clean condenser and remote condensing connections per manufacturer schedule to maintain efficiency. Use non-abrasive cloths and approved cleaners for stainless steel. Inspect seals and LED lighting; replace worn gaskets. #@@# Refrigeration System#@#
The remote refrigeration architecture pairs with a full-length gravity coil to provide uniform temperature distribution across the display area. The included R-448A expansion valve ensures refrigerant control compatible with remote condensing units while supporting efficient heat transfer for frequent door openings.
#@@# Sanitation-Oriented Design#@#
Stainless-steel interior and exterior surfaces resist corrosion and allow for aggressive cleaning regimens used in seafood and poultry handling. Three removable stainless-steel ice pans with drains facilitate straightforward ice replenishment and rapid water removal to control melt and bacterial risk.
#@@# Display Efficiency#@#
Straight front glass and an upper-level gravity coil optimize sightlines and product drainage, keeping merchandised items visible and in prime condition. The single-shelf configuration enables organized staging of trays and packaging for rapid restocking during peak service periods.
#@@# Electrical Specification#@#
The unit operates on 115 volts, 60 hertz, single-phase power and draws 1.3 amps, supporting compatibility with standard commercial circuits. A 12,130 BTU rating indicates cooling capacity appropriate for extended service in busy deli, market, or institutional settings.

Flush stainless steel ice pan drains monthly and test for clear flow. Sanitize interior surfaces and pans after each shift using a food-safe sanitizer; rinse thoroughly. Verify door seals and straight glass alignment weekly, replace compromised gaskets immediately. Record amperage and condenser pressures monthly and schedule professional service for refrigerant R-448A leaks.
